Summary
Jeffrey Ward was convicted in federal district court of possession with intent to distribute cocaine base in two separate counts involving 57.9 grams and 70.2 grams respectively. On January 19, 2017, President Barack Obama commuted Ward's sentence. The record does not specify the original sentence imposed, the district court of conviction, the year of conviction, or conditions attached to the commutation.
